Module:Location map/data/Bosnia and Herzegovina
This Lua module is used on approximately 3,700 pages and changes may be widely noticed. Test changes in the module's /sandbox or /testcases subpages. Consider discussing changes on the talk page before implementing them.
Transclusion count updated automatically (see documentation). |
name | Bosnia and Herzegovina | |||
---|---|---|---|---|
border coordinates | ||||
45.4 | ||||
15.5 | ←↕→ | 19.9 | ||
42.4 | ||||
map center | [ ⚑ ] 43°54′N 17°42′E / 43.9°N 17.7°E | |||
image | Bosnia and Herzegovina location map.svg
| |||
image1 | Bosnia and Herzegovina relief location map.png
| |||
Module:Location map/data/Bosnia and Herzegovina is a location map definition used to overlay markers and labels on an equirectangular projection map of Bosnia and Herzegovina. The markers are placed by latitude and longitude coordinates on the default map or a similar map image.
Usage
These definitions are used by the following templates when invoked with parameter "Bosnia and Herzegovina":
{{Location map|Bosnia and Herzegovina |...}}
{{Location map many|Bosnia and Herzegovina |...}}
{{Location map+|Bosnia and Herzegovina |...}}
{{Location map~|Bosnia and Herzegovina |...}}
Map definition
name = Bosnia and Herzegovina
- Name used in the default map caption
image = Bosnia and Herzegovina location map.svg
- The default map image, without "Image:" or "File:"
image1 = Bosnia and Herzegovina relief location map.png
- An alternative map image, usually a relief map, which can be displayed via the relief or AlternativeMap parameters
top = 45.4
- Latitude at top edge of map, in decimal degrees
bottom = 42.4
- Latitude at bottom edge of map, in decimal degrees
left = 15.5
- Longitude at left edge of map, in decimal degrees
right = 19.9
- Longitude at right edge of map, in decimal degrees
Alternative map
The {{Location map}}, {{Location map many}}, and {{Location map+}} templates have parameters to specify an alternative map image. The map displayed as image1 can be used with the relief or AlternativeMap parameters. Examples may be found below or in the following:
- Template:Location map#Relief parameter
- Template:Location map+/relief
- Template:Location map#AlternativeMap parameter
- Template:Location map+/AlternativeMap
Precision
Longitude: from West to East this map definition covers 4.4 degrees.
- At an image width of 200 pixels, that is 0.022 degrees per pixel.
- At an image width of 1000 pixels, that is 0.0044 degrees per pixel.
Latitude: from North to South this map definition covers 3 degrees.
- At an image height of 200 pixels, that is 0.015 degrees per pixel.
- At an image height of 1000 pixels, that is 0.003 degrees per pixel.
Examples using location map templates
Location map, using default map (image)
{{Location map | Bosnia and Herzegovina | width = 200 | label = Sarajevo | lat_deg = 43.85 | lon_deg = 18.36 }}
Location map many, using relief map (image1)
{{Location map many | Bosnia and Herzegovina | relief = yes | width = 200 | caption = Two locations in Bosnia and Herzegovina | label1 = Sarajevo | lat1_deg = 43.85 | lon1_deg = 18.36 | label2 = Banja Luka | lat2_deg = 44.77 | lon2_deg = 17.18 }}
Location map+, using AlternativeMap
{{Location map+ | Bosnia and Herzegovina | AlternativeMap = Bosnia and Herzegovina relief location map.png | width = 200 | caption = Two locations in Bosnia and Herzegovina | places = {{Location map~ | Bosnia and Herzegovina | label = Sarajevo | lat_deg = 43.85 | lon_deg = 18.36 }} {{Location map~ | Bosnia and Herzegovina | label = Banja Luka | lat_deg = 44.77 | lon_deg = 17.18 }} }}
See also
Location map templates
- Template:Location map, to display one mark and label using latitude and longitude
- Template:Location map many, to display up to nine marks and labels
- Template:Location map+, to display an unlimited number of marks and labels
Creating new map definitions
return { name = 'Bosnia and Herzegovina', top = 45.4, bottom = 42.4, left = 15.5, right = 19.9, image = 'Bosnia and Herzegovina location map.svg', image1 = 'Bosnia and Herzegovina relief location map.png' }